BREACHES OF LICENSING ACT.

'(1 Vr L'ress Assoeiat ion.) WANGANUI, Nov. 28. At the Police Court at AVaverley yesterday Mr Stanford, S M., fined McKenzio, tlie licensee of the Waito-tni-ii Hotel, £2 and costs for supplying liijuor to in intoxicated native at Waveiiev inces on Nov. 'J, and ordered the license to lie endorsed. ]snt! i rlield, the bni-inan, was lin-s £lO a: d costs 011 a similar charge. Notice of appeal was given.
